ADMINISTRATIVE ASSISTANT –  USP

JOB DESCRIPTION & SKILLS/QUALIFICATIONS REQUIRED

 

The Opportunity

The appointee will provide a wide range of administrative and secretarial support to Library Management, heads of sections/units/staff groups inclusive of the management of the offices of the University Librarian and the Deputy University Librarian.

Administrative and secretarial responsibilities include but are not restricted to:
– Timely secretarial and administrative support;
– Memo/minute and report writing and the preparation and organization of correspondence and reports as required that may be confidential in nature;
– Records management inclusive of the maintenance and updating of the established Library international filing system;
– Advice and assistance to other staff (seniors, clerk/typists) in the area of office management;
– Participation in discussions of new and revised procedures and practices and evaluation of these in addition to making recommendations for follow-up actions;
– Assistance in interpretation of administrative rules, regulations and procedures of the Library and the University;
– Organization of annual events and workshops, meetings, internal training and conferences and social activities;
– Management of the Library Advisory Committee in consultation with the Secretary, LAC (DUL) ;
– HR duties: assist with the preparation of job advertisements and position descriptions and HR processes;
– Customer service related aspects of the Library’s administration and management;
– Direct or indirect oversight of the building maintenance, security and transport;
– Liaison with and management of back-up roster for clerical staff;
– To work with a wide range of persons that includes senior library staff, academic staff, students, University Senior Management Team (SMT), diplomats and members of the University Council along with local, regional and international personnel linked to the Library through the provision of services, funding and products.

The Person We Seek

To be considered for this position, applicants must have:

– Bachelor’s Degree and Must have 2 years’ experience or more in similar role;
– demonstrated proficiency in written and spoken English;
– knowledge of administrative procedures and processes;
– demonstrated ability to write and provide high quality memorandum and reports under tight deadlines;
– excellent numerical and organisational skills;
– self-motivation and be able to work under pressure without routine supervision;
– excellent interpersonal and team playing skills with the ability to work with and establish rapport with staff at all levels in a multicultural environment;
– Above average knowledge of a range of software to support administration work;
– Flexibility and willingness to accommodate change and demonstrate experience consistent with the requirements of the position.
Preference will be given to applicants with:
– An equivalent combination of relevant experience and/or education/training;
– intermediate or Advanced Certificates in Microsoft Office;
– knowledge of administrative procedures and processes in an academic environment.

Salary Range: FJ $32,246 to FJ $38,138 per annum
